This is a fast-paced Recruitment Sourcer role within the Business Support team at Michael Page, focused on managing 40-50 vacancies and overseeing the full candidate lifecycle from sourcing through to placement and billing. It offers hybrid working in Edinburgh, a competitive salary (25k-34k), and uncapped monthly commission, with no requirement for business development or cold calling.
Michael Page is a globally recognised recruitment consultancy, part of PageGroup, with a strong reputation for delivering specialist recruitment solutions across a wide range of sectors. Our Edinburgh office is well‐established and centrally located, offering a professional yet collaborative working environment.
You will be joining a close‐knit Business Support team that is supportive, social, and delivery‐focused, with a strong track record of success. The team works at pace while maintaining high standards, offering a great opportunity to develop your skills within a well‐structured and reputable organisation.
- Manage approximately 40-50 live vacancies at any given time
- Oversee the full candidate lifecycle, including sourcing, screening, and shortlisting candidates
- Coordinate interviews and manage stakeholder communication
- Conduct compliance checks and ensure all documentation is in place
- Support candidates and clients through to successful placement and billing admin
